The Autumnal Welsh Witch And Her Cats
πππΈοΈπββ¬π§πββ¬πΈοΈππ
Rhiannon In The Forest
Eleven Cats That Do Hiss
Wind Is Blowing Her White Dress
Autumn Leaves Falling Caress
Her, The Spider Web, A Test
Under The Beautiful Moon
Casting A Rune, Cats To Bless
